A perfect mastery of slicing

This Kai Shun Classic White kitchen knife, featuring a VG-10 blade encased in 32 layers of Damascus steel, offers exceptionally fine cutting performance and excellent wear resistance thanks to its 61 HRC hardness. Its overall length of 32.2 cm and its 20 cm blade allow for precise, effortless movements, perfectly suited to delicate preparations such as slicing onions or cutting thin slices of meat. The carefully polished light ash wood handle provides a comfortable, non-slip grip that remains stable even in wet conditions. This durable material naturally conforms to the hand, minimizing fatigue.

Maintenance tips

Wash this knife exclusively by hand in warm water with a mild soap to preserve the Damascus steel and steel layers. Dry it immediately to prevent corrosion or staining. Never put it in the dishwasher to avoid damaging the blade or the pakkawood handle. To maintain a sharp edge, hone the blade regularly with a sharpener.Japanese water stonesuitable for VG-10. Store your knife in a block or on a magnetic bar, in a dry place.

Frequently Asked Questions

Is this knife suitable for slicing vegetables?

Yes, the 20cm blade, thin and well balanced, allows you to slice onion, garlic, carrot or other vegetables with ease and precision.

How often should the blade be sharpened?

VG-10 steel offers extended edge retention, but regular sharpening with a Japanese whetstone helps maintain optimal sharpness.

Is the handle resistant to water and humidity?

The pakka wood is stabilized to offer resistance to moisture, but it is advisable to dry the knife thoroughly after each wash to maintain the durability of the handle.

How to care for and wash your professional kitchen clothes?

To preserve the quality and durability of your chef jackets and professional clothing, follow these care instructions:

Washing


  • Machine wash at a maximum of 40°C to preserve the integrity of the fabric (polycotton, polyester, cotton).

  • Use a mild detergent.

  • Avoid bleach and harsh fabric softeners that can damage fibers and colors.

Drying


  • Opt for air drying to limit premature wear of the fabric.

  • If you use a tumble dryer, choose a low temperature program to protect the polyester fibers.

Ironing


  • Iron at medium temperature (approximately 150°C) .

  • Turn the garment inside out before ironing to protect logos, embroidery and personalized markings.

Practical advice


  • Treat stains before washing for best results.

  • Wash similar colors together to avoid any color bleeding.

By following these care recommendations, you will extend the life of your professional kitchen clothing while maintaining a neat and professional appearance, essential in the catering industry.

Polycotton (65% polyester, 35% cotton) is a material particularly suited to demanding work environments such as catering, the medical sector, construction and industry .

It offers several major advantages:

Strength and durability

More resistant than 100% cotton, polycotton withstands frequent washing, friction and intensive working conditions.

Easy care

Resistant to wrinkling and quick-drying, it is ideal for everyday use in a professional environment.

Optimal comfort

It combines the softness of cotton with the lightness and flexibility of polyester, ensuring lasting comfort during long working days.

Resistance to stains and stress

Thanks to polyester, the fabric absorbs less liquid and dries faster, making it easier to care for medical uniforms, kitchen clothes and industrial workwear .

Excellent value for money

Polycotton is more economical than 100% natural fabrics while maintaining excellent quality and long lifespan.

Polycotton is therefore a strategic choice for professionals in healthcare, catering, construction and industry looking for durable, comfortable and easy-care workwear .
